The Flyweight Pattern is a structural design pattern that helps reduce memory consumption and boost performance by sharing common data across multiple objects. It’s a smart choice when you have a large number of similar objects and want to optimize your resource usage by cutting down redundancy.

Why Use the Flyweight Pattern?

  • Memory Efficiency : By reusing common properties across objects, the pattern saves memory and eliminates unnecessary duplication.

  • Performance Boost : With fewer unique objects in memory, your app runs smoother, making the Flyweight Pattern a key tool for performance optimization.

  • Consistency : Centralizing shared properties ensures consistent behavior and data across the application.

How It Works :

  • Intrinsic State : Shared data between objects. For example, in a game, attributes like color or texture of characters can be reused to minimize memory usage.

  • Extrinsic State : Unique data specific to each object. In the game example, attributes like a character’s position or health are unique to each instance.

  • Flyweight Factory : A central object that handles the creation of flyweights, ensuring common data is shared where needed.

Common Use Cases :

  • Graphical Applications : For apps that render many similar elements (like characters, trees, or icons), sharing visual properties through Flyweight can dramatically cut down memory use.
  • Data Caching : Great for cases where you frequently access common, reusable data, enhancing the efficiency of your app.

  • Text Editors :Displaying large documents involves handling thousands of characters. Flyweight allows text editors to share common properties like fonts and styles, optimizing memory use.

Real-World Example :

Picture a 2D game with hundreds of trees. Instead of creating an individual object for each tree with its own color and texture, you can share these attributes across all trees. This approach cuts down memory use and speeds up rendering, especially for large scenes.

When to Use It ?

The Flyweight Pattern is ideal when you have many similar objects and want to eliminate redundancy by sharing common properties. It’s particularly effective in memory-intensive scenarios.
